Regular Joe is a song sung by Millie in the Helluva Boss episode "Unhappy Campers". The lyrics appear at the bottom of the screen, encouraging viewers to sing along.

Trivia[]

  • This song is also Millie's first solo, excluding her singing along with Moxxie in "Oh, Millie" and "Til the Day We Die".
  • The Breading Cat meme can be briefly glimpsed in the live chat during the "Regular Joe" song.
    • One teen's profile picture on the live chat features her reading what appears to be the cover of Twilight.
  • According to storyboard artist, Gavin Arucan, the choreography of Troy Bolton performing the song "Bet on It" from the Disney Channel movie High School Musical 2 was used as direct reference for Millie's movements throughout the song.[1]
  • One of the comments in the live chat of Millerd's performance of "Regular Joe" says "CLICK HERE FOR PRIZE >>> scam(dot)ly". A reference to real-life comments online made by bots to get unsuspecting people's accounts hacked or devices get installed with viruses.
  • At one point, Millie's head briefly morphed into a handsome face resembling the Handsome Squidward design from SpongeBob SquarePants.
